San Martín Contratistas Generales is awarded a contract for ADIF in Spain.

San Martín Contratistas Generales strengthens its position as a benchmark in the Ibero-American mining sector with a new earthworks contract in Spain.

San Martín, a leading contractor in mining operations, construction, and infrastructure services, has been awarded a new contract to provide earthworks and auxiliary works for the construction of the Tafalla – Campanas section of the High-Speed Train (AVE) and train parking facilities. This project involves the development of the new rail line that will reach Pamplona, in Navarra, Spain.

This contract, executed with General de Maquinaria y Excavación – GME for the consortium formed by Obras y Servicios Copasa, Puentes y Calzadas Infraestructuras, Constructora San José, and Lurpelan Tunnelling, and awarded by ADIF Spain, includes a significant investment in equipment to support the project. Among these are a CAT 352 excavator, two CAT D6N and CAT D6R track-type tractors, six CAT 740 articulated trucks, and a water tanker.

The construction sector is a fundamental pillar of the economy in Spain and Europe. According to recent data, in Spain, the construction industry represents approximately 5.6% of GDP and employs more than 1.3 million people. These figures highlight the sector’s importance not only as a source of employment but also as a driver of economic growth, innovation, and sustainable development. Projects such as the AVE Tafalla – Campanas section not only improve infrastructure and connectivity but also boost local and regional economic growth.
